Visual Observation Scale for the Upper Limb During Walking in Patients After Stroke.

GaitHemiplegic2 more

For several years now, it has been demonstrated that the upper limb plays an important role in the function of an efficient and balanced gait pattern in healthy adults. After a stroke, the reduced muscle strength has a clear influence on the gait pattern, but also on the active movement possibilities of the upper limb. However, the role of the upper limb during gait is not sufficiently explored in the literature. The gold standard for motion analysis is a 3D analysis performed with infrared cameras capturing reflective markers during gait. Unfortunately, it is not possible for all people after a stroke to undergo this examination. On the one hand, patients must already have a certain degree of independence with regard to gait. On the other hand, not all centers have access to this expensive accommodation. There are some validated observation scales for people after stroke to describe the gait based on a 2D video image. This method is much more accessible and can be applied by any therapist. However, to date there has been little attention paid to the upper limb in these observation scales. Therefore, analogous to the observation scales for gait, an observation scale for the upper limb during gait was set up. The use of this scale can add value to the rehabilitation of people after a stroke. The treatment team will receive information about the patient's complete movement pattern. The arm will be more prominent when setting rehabilitation goals related to gait. This can lead to a positive effect on the gait pattern itself, but also to more attention being paid to the arm, which has a more difficult recovery than the leg after a stroke. The aim of the current study will be to determine the inter and intra tester reliability of this visual observation scale to investigate if the results of the visual observation scale correlate to a 3D assessment performed in a subgroup of participants

Osmotic Agent Use in Middle Cerebral Artery Stroke

Ischemic StrokeMCA Infarction

This is a retrospective chart review of patients that were admitted with large MCA stroke to the Fairview system hospitals between December 2017-December 2018. Patients ischemic stroke volumes will be measured by taking the area of the infarction and multiplying it by the thickness of each CT or MRI slice, the summation of these volumes is the final volume of the ischemic lesion in cubic centimeters. Patients with stroke volumes greater than 70 cc will be included in the study. Patient midline shift will be measured in millimeters at the level of foramen of Monroe anytime during their initial admission and all patients with a shift greater than 1mm will be included. The midline shift will be documented on the first follow-up brain scan (CT or MRI) at least six hours after the initiation of osmotic therapy. Data will be collected from patient charts including: Age, sex, NIHSS on presentation and discharge, history of diabetes mellitus, hypertension, coronary artery disease, atrial fibrillation, and chronic kidney disease. The type of osmotherapy, along with change in serum sodium or osmolality and dose, will also be documented. In patients that did not receive osmotherapy, midline shift will be documented on the first 24-hour scan and every subsequent scan in 24-hour intervals. Death during a hospital stay will also be recorded. The investigators will use the SAS statistical suite to analyze this data.

Getting on With the Rest of Your Life After a Stroke

Stroke

The primary objective is to determine the extent to which participation in life's roles can be optimized through the provision of a community-based structured program providing the opportunity for physical activity, leisure, and social interaction. A secondary objective is to estimate the extent to which participation is associated with health benefits including health-related quality of life and reduction of unplanned health-care encounters for the person with stroke and reduction of burden and improvement in quality of life for caregivers.

Swiss Intravenous and Intra-arterial Thrombolysis for Treatment of Acute Ischemic Stroke Registry...

Ischemic Stroke

The clinical and radiological data of patients with an acute ischemic stroke treated with intravenous thrombolysis (IVT) or intraarterial thrombolysis (IAT) in a Swiss stroke unit are assessed in a Swiss Multicenter Thrombolysis Registry. Like in clinical routine, a clinical evaluation takes place in a 3-months follow-up. Furthermore quality of life is assessed with a standardized questionnaire. The aim of the registry is to compare the safety and efficacy of IVT and IAT in patients with acute ischemic stroke. The registry also helps to improve in-hospital-management of stroke patients.

The Effect of Implementing Hyper-acute Stroke Guidelines on Decision-Making for or Against Thrombolytic...

Stroke

The objective of this study is to determine if the implementation of guidelines utilizing immediate CT Perfusion and CT Angiography in addition to non-contrast CT alters (reduces or increases) the time to decision-making for or against rt-PA in acute ischemic stroke, and by extension, time to therapy in treated patients and time to transfer from the department for all patients. A secondary objective is to determine if using CTP/CTA-inclusive hyperacute stroke guidelines improves safety by decreasing symptomatic intracerebral hemorrhage and mortality in patients who receive rt-PA.

a Water Training Program to Improve Balance in Chronic Stroke Patients

Chronic Stroke Patients

The proposed project is a case control study design. Subject's suffer from stroke willing to participate in the study will be shortly interviewed to assess eligibility according to the inclusion-exclusion criteria. Subjects suffer from chronic hemiplegia that upon questioning was judged to meet the following inclusion criteria: (a) able to stand independently 90 seconds; (b) able to walk 10 meters (with cane if necessary); (c) able to understand verbal instructions. The exclusion criteria will be: (a) Serious visual impairment; (b) Inability to ambulate independently (cane acceptable, walker not). (c) Severely impaired cognitive status (score less then 24 in Mini Mental State Examination). (d) Persons with impaired communication capabilities. The whole project will be conducted over a period of 3 months. A total of 36 subjects will be assigned to water based exercise program. The exercise group will meet on 24 occasions over a period of 12 weeks (2 times/week). The subjects of the exercise group will be recruited from Sha'ar Ha'negev Swimming pool and from patients that get a Physical Therapy treatment Kupat Holim Clalit. Gait and balance function will be tested in both groups with well established measuring techniques before and after the training period. The measuring techniques 1) Medical background variables. 2) Berg Balance Scale. 3) Late life Function and Disability Instrument. 4) Get up and go test - stand up and walk 3 meters turn around and walk back to the chair. 5) step execution test under single and dual task; 5) stability tests. 6) also fall will be monitored a year after the completion of the study. The water training intervention is performed on different levels where each level reflects different increasing demands on the postural control system. For example, the instructor can increase the difficulty of a certain water-exercise by instructing a participant to use less external support, close the eyes, decrease the support area (stand on one leg or narrow the stance, or on unstable surface). These "tools" allow the instructor to implement step exercises on a group level that are still challenging for each individual even if the skill level in the group varies. The water exercises also include perturbation exercises that trigger specific reflex-like balance responses. On each level the instructor can instantly modify an exercise to be more or less challenging for each participant.
